Speed Signal Circuit [10/2015 - 12/2017]: Procedure

  1. INSPECT ECU TERMINAL VOLTAGE (INPUT VOLTAGE) 
    1. Disconnect the J10 combination meter assembly connector.
      GTY613189Courtesy of © TOYOTA, LICENSE AGREEMENT TMS1002
      *a Front view of wire harness connector
      (to Combination Meter Assembly)
    2. Measure the voltage according to the value (s) in the table below.

      Standard Voltage

      Tester Connection Condition Specified Condition
      J10-19 (+S) - Body ground Power switch on (IG) 4.5 to 14 V

      HINT: 

      If any of the ECUs specified in the wiring diagram supplies power to the combination meter assembly, the combination meter assembly will output a waveform.

  3. INSPECT SKID CONTROL ECU ASSEMBLY (INPUT WAVEFORM) 
    1. Check the input waveform.
      GTY638843Courtesy of © TOYOTA, LICENSE AGREEMENT TMS1002
      *a Component with harness connected
      (Combination Meter Assembly)
      1. Reconnect the A61 skid control ECU assembly connector.
      2. Remove the combination meter assembly with the connector (s) still connected.
      3. Connect an oscilloscope to terminal J10-20 (SI) and body ground.
      4. Turn the power switch on (IG).
      5. Turn a wheel slowly.
      6. Check the signal waveform according to the condition (s) in the table below.
        Item Condition
        Tool setting 5 V/DIV., 20 ms./DIV.
        Vehicle condition Power switch on (IG), wheel being rotated

        OK

        The waveform is similar to that shown in the illustration.

        HINT: 

        When the system is functioning normally, one wheel revolution generates 4 pulses. As the vehicle speed increases, the width indicated by (A) in the illustration narrows.

  4. CHECK HARNESS AND CONNECTOR (COMBINATION METER ASSEMBLY - SKID CONTROL ECU ASSEMBLY) 
    1. Disconnect the J10 combination meter assembly connector.
    2. Measure the resistance according to the value (s) in the table below.

      Standard Resistance

      Tester Connection Condition Specified Condition
      J10-20 (SI) - A61-22 (SP1) Always Below 1 Ω
      J10-20 (SI) or A61-22 (SP1) - Body ground Always 10 kΩ or higher
